(BaseballStL) -- Mike Matheny said Tuesday morning that Lance Lynn has developed some soreness in his hamstring. 
 
Lynn is scheduled to throw a bullpen session, but may decide to skip it.  Matheny has told the players, especially the younger guys, not to try to make the team in the first few days of camp.  He doesn't want anybody over-extending themselves right now to try and impress coaches and get hurt with six more weeks of spring training still to go. 
 
Today's inspiration quote of the day from Matheny, printed on the bottom of the workout schedule, is from Aristotle: "We are what we repeatedly do. Excellence, then, is not an act, but a habit."
 
Former Cardinals team president Mark Lamping visited the camp on Tuesday.  Lamping recently accepted a job as president of the Jacksonville Jaguars. He's in the process of moving to Florida for his first job with an NFL team.
